Teach various age groups and skill levels in accordance with instructional guidelines while maintaining a safe environment. Responsibilities include planning lessons, demonstrating proper techniques, and communicating progress to students and parents.
Candidates must be at least 16 years old and possess or be able to obtain CPR/AED, First Aid, and Red Cross Lifeguarding certifications. Prior experience in lifeguarding or swim instruction is highly preferred.
